Cost of Barn Slab Pouring in Richland

Pouring a barn slab in Richland, WA, involves various costs influenced by multiple factors. Understanding these factors can help you budget effectively and ensure a successful project. This guide provides an overview of the elements that affect the cost and the common tasks involved in barn slab pouring.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Slab: Larger slabs require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
  • Thickness of the Slab: Thicker slabs use more concrete, leading to higher expenses.
  • Site Preparation: Costs for clearing and leveling the site can vary based on terrain and accessibility.
  • Concrete Quality: Higher-grade concrete mixes are more expensive but offer better durability.
  • Reinforcement Materials: The use of rebar or wire mesh adds to the cost but strengthens the slab.
  • Labor Costs: Labor rates in Richland, WA, can fluctuate, affecting the total expenditure.
  •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
  • Weather Conditions: Adverse weather can delay the project and increase labor costs.

Common Tasks and Costs

Task Average Cost (Richland, WA)
Site Preparation $1,000 - $3,000
Concrete (per cubic yard) $125 - $150
Reinforcement Materials $0.30 - $0.50 per sq. ft.
Labor (per hour) $50 - $75
Pouring and Finishing $2 - $4 per sq. ft.
Permits and Inspections $200 - $500

Understanding these factors and average costs can help you plan your barn slab pouring project in Richland, WA, more effectively.
